JAVA中常用需要设置的三个

来源:互联网 发布:高句丽最大版图知乎 编辑:程序博客网 时间:2024/05/21 09:10
导读:
  JAVA_HOME 、CLASSPATH、PATH
  (一)  配置环境变量:(相对路径)
  1.
  JAVA_HOME=x:/jdk1.6.0 JAVA_HOME
  2.
  用%JAVA_HOME%就可以取代:x:/jdk1.6.0这一部分
  CLASSPATH
  .:$JAVA_HOME/lib/tools.jar:$JAVA_HOME/lib/dt.jar:$JAVA_HOME/lib/activation.jar:$JAVA_HOME/lib/mail.jar
  或
  CLASSPATH
  ./;%JAVA_HOME%/lib/tools.jar;%JAVA_HOME%/lib/dt.jar
  3.
  PATH 
  %JAVA_HOME%/bin
  (二)  配置环境变量:(绝对路径)
  1.
  Java_HOME
  D:/jdk1.5.0
  2.
  CLASSPATH
  .;D:/jdk1.5.0/lib/tools.jar;D:/jdk1.5.0/jre/lib/rt.jar;
  3.
  PATH
  D:/jdk1.5.0/bin;
  (三)
  把下面的代码用批处理执行,对设置环境变量会很方便的
  @echo off
  IF EXIST %1/bin/java.exe (
  rem 如输入正确的 Java2SDK 安装目录,开始设置环境变量
  @setx JAVA_HOME %1
  @setx path %path%;%JAVA_HOME%/bin
  @setx classpath %classpath%;.
  @setx classpath %classpath%;%JAVA_HOME%/lib/tools.jar
  @setx classpath %classpath%;%JAVA_HOME%/lib/dt.jar
  @setx classpath %classpath%;%JAVA_HOME%/jre/lib/rt.jar
  @echo on
  @echo Java 2 SDK 环境参数设置完毕,正常退出。
  ) ELSE (
  IF "%1"=="" (
  rem 如没有提供安装目录,提示之后退出
  @echo on
  @echo 没有提供 Java2SDK 的安装目录,不做任何设置,现在退出环境变量设置。
  ) ELSE (
  rem 如果提供非空的安装目录但没有bin/java.exe,则指定的目录为错误的目录
  @echo on
  @echo 非法的 Java2SDK 的安装目录,不做任何设置,现在退出环境变量设置。

本文转自
http://220.181.18.117/sunyujiang/blog/item/98e08a0e6ff8dee436d12293.html